For his debut solo album Beatitude in 1982, Ocasek put his experimental foot forward to create an album that included his trademark Cars sound, but also veered into a more electronic direction. Aided by drum machines and bringing keyboards to the forefront, Beatitude spawned two well-received singles. Something To Grab For could have fit on any Cars album with it's upbeat and catchy hook, while Jimmy Jimmy takes a serious tone tackling teenage hardships and challenges. This newly remastered CD edition now includes several bonus tracks, including the 1983 re-recording of Jimmy Jimmy in both it's single and dance mix versions. Also included are remixes of the electro-epic Connect Up To Me and the soulful Prove.
